s.replace("\n","").split(",")可以吗?
时间: 2024-06-17 10:02:03 浏览: 4
这个Python代码片段是用于字符串处理的。具体来说,它执行了两个操作:
1. `s.replace("\n","")`:这个操作使用了字符串的replace方法,将所有的`\n`(换行符)替换为空字符串,也就是删除所有换行。这样做的目的是将原始字符串s中的所有换行符去除,使字符串变成一行文本。
2. `split(",")`:接下来,使用split方法,以逗号","为分隔符将处理后的字符串分割成一个列表。这意味着每个由逗号分隔的部分都会成为一个单独的元素,列表中的元素将是原始字符串中原来由逗号分隔的子串。
举个例子,如果`s`是一个包含多个项目,每个项目后跟逗号分隔的字符串,比如:"项目1, 项目2\n项目3, 项目4",那么`s.replace("\n","").split(",")`会将其转换为`["项目1, 项目2", "项目3, 项目4"]`这样的列表。
相关问题
s.append(i.replace("\n","").split(","))
在Python中,`s.append(i.replace("\n","").split(","))` 这行代码是用来处理字符串列表操作的。这里有几个关键点:
1. `i.replace("\n", "")`:这行代码的作用是将字符串 `i` 中的所有`\n`(换行符)替换为空字符串,从而去掉字符串中的换行。
2. `split(",")`:这部分使用的是 `split()` 方法,它会根据逗号 `,` 将替换掉换行后的字符串 `i` 切分成多个子字符串,并返回一个列表。每个子字符串都是原字符串中由逗号分隔的部分。
3. `s.append()`:最后,这段代码将上述处理后的子字符串列表添加到名为 `s` 的列表的末尾。
整体来看,如果 `s` 是一个空列表或已经存在的列表,这段代码会对每个字符串元素 `i` 执行转义换行符为无、然后按逗号拆分的操作,并将结果追加到列表 `s` 中。
(3)输入s="PythonString",再输入下面语句,理解字符串运算 s. upper(): s. lower(): s: s. find('i'): (s. replace('.ing',’gni'): t=s. split(''),t
好的,根据您的要求,我回答如下:
假设输入 s="PythonString",则:
- s.upper():将字符串 s 转换为大写,结果为:"PYTHONSTRING"。
- s.lower():将字符串 s 转换为小写,结果为:"pythonstring"。
- s:输出字符串 s 原来的值,即:"PythonString"。
- s.find('i'):查找字符串 s 中第一次出现字符'i'的位置,结果为:6,因为'i'第一次出现在下标为6的位置。
- s.replace('.ing','gni'):将字符串 s 中所有以".ing"结尾的子串替换为"gni",结果为:"PythonString",因为 s 中并没有以".ing"结尾的子串。
- t=s.split(''):将字符串 s 按照空字符进行切割,结果为 ["P", "y", "t", "h", "o", "n", "S", "t", "r", "i", "n", "g"],即将每个字符作为一个子串放入列表中。
希望我的回答能够帮助到您!
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![docx](https://img-home.csdnimg.cn/images/20210720083331.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)